Bobi Wine Arrives for Presidential Nominations amid Heavy Teargas

Photo Credit: New Vision

The Police have this Tuesday morning thrown teargas canisters at the National Unity Platform (NUP) supporters in Magere all through to Kisasi, Ntinda and Nakawa who formed a procession and attempted to accompany their presidential aspirant, Robert Kyagulanyi, to Kyambogo for nominations.

The Electoral Commission had banned processions during the nomination process.

By press time, Kyagulanyi had arrived to appear before the Electoral Commission to be nominated today for the 2021 Presidential elections
